What is an Ignition Key?
The ignition key is a small metal instrument utilized to start a vehicle's engine. It operates the ignition switch, which allows electrical existing to flow to the engine and other important parts. Ignition keys can vary considerably in style, performance, and innovation, depending on the vehicle's make and design.
Types of Ignition Keys
To better comprehend ignition keys, it assists to categorize them based upon their style and functionality. Below is a table highlighting different kinds of ignition keys:
| Type of Ignition Key | Description | Examples |
|---|---|---|
| Standard Key | A basic metal key that physically turns in the ignition switch to begin the engine. | Older designs from manufacturers like Ford and Chevrolet. |
| Transponder Key | Includes a chip that interacts with the vehicle's immobilizer system, supplying an added layer of security. | Lots of modern Nissan, Honda, and Toyota cars. |
| Smart Key/ Key Fob | A push-button control that permits keyless entry and engine start, using innovative technology. | High-end brands like BMW, Mercedes-Benz, and Tesla. |
| Switchblade Key | A mix of a traditional key and a remote, featuring a folding blade for benefit. | Some designs from Chevrolet and Jeep. |
| Mechanical Key | A simple key without any electronic elements, normally discovered in older vehicles. | Classic cars from different makers. |
How Does an Ignition Key Work?
The ignition key's primary function is to engage the ignition system of the vehicle. When the key is inserted into the ignition switch and turned, it completes a circuit that powers the fuel pump and the ignition coil, leading to the engine beginning. Here's a brief overview of how the ignition key operates:
- Inserting the Key: The key is placed into the ignition switch.
- Turning the Key: Turning the key activates the electrical system, which powers the dashboard lights and fuel shipment.
- Sparking the Engine: The key turns the ignition coil, which creates a spark to ignite the fuel in the engine cylinders.
- Engine Start: Once the engine starts, the ignition key is released to a neutral position, allowing the engine to run.
Modern cars utilize innovative ignition systems that might require additional steps, such as pressing a button and having the key fob inside the vehicle.
Typical Issues with Ignition Keys
The ignition key is not unsusceptible to issues. Below are some typical concerns that can occur:
- Worn-Out Keys: Over time, keys can wear down, making it challenging to turn in the ignition.
- Transponder Malfunction: If the transponder chip in the key stops working, the vehicle may not begin.
- Ignition Switch Failure: A malfunctioning ignition switch can avoid the key from engaging the engine.
- Key Fob Battery Failure: If the battery in a clever key or key fob passes away, the vehicle will not react to the key.
- Physical Damage: Keys can become bent or broken, requiring immediate replacement.
Preventative Measures
To avoid ignition key issues, vehicle owners can take the following steps:
- Regularly inspect the key for signs of wear and tear.
- Replace batteries in key fobs as needed.
- Keep ignition switches clean and totally free from debris.
- Do not force a key into the ignition; this can lead to further damage.
Frequently Asked Questions About Ignition Keys
Q1: Can I configure a transponder key myself?
A1: While some lorries allow for DIY programming, a lot of require specific devices or a dealership to configure a transponder key. It is a good idea to consult your vehicle's manual or an expert locksmith.
Q2: What should I do if my ignition key gets stuck?
A2: If your key gets stuck in the ignition, avoid requiring it. Examine if the vehicle is in "Park" or "Neutral," as some models have security systems that prevent the key from turning. If the key remains stuck, speak with a mechanic for help.
Q3: Can a locksmith aid with a damaged ignition key?
A3: Yes, a qualified locksmith can typically extract broken ignition keys and produce a duplicate if you have a spare. They can also assist in rekeying the ignition if required.
Q4: How typically should I replace my ignition key?
A4: There is no particular timeline for replacing ignition keys. Nevertheless, if you discover indications of wear or problem beginning the vehicle, it may be time for a replacement.
Q5: What occurs if I lose my ignition key?
A5: If you lose your ignition key, you must call a locksmith or your vehicle dealer to have a new key made. They may require evidence of ownership to develop a replacement.
